Web6 CHAPTER 1. PARTIAL DERIVATIVES when yand zare kept constant. Partial derivatives can be computed using the same di erentiation techniques as in single-variable calculus, but one must be careful, when di erentiating with respect to one variable, to treat all other variables as if they are constant. WebOct 31, 2016 · The partial derivatives commute in this particular case since x, y are independent. That is, ∂ x / ∂ y = ∂ y / ∂ x = 0. It is not the case, however, that arbitrary partial derivatives commute. For example, if we were to introduce r = x 2 + y 2, then the partials would not commute. ∂ ∂ x ∂ ∂ r f ( x, y) ≠ ∂ ∂ r ∂ ∂ x f ( x, y)
